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the sinking will influence the repair method and cost.
- Type of Concrete: Different types of concrete, such as stamped or stained, can affect the cost.
- Area Size: Larger areas will generally require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require special equipment or additional labor.
- Soil Condition: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ional stabilization measures.
- Repair Method: Methods like m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ection can vary in cost.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Spartanburg, SC, will impact the overall exp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Spartanburg, SC) |
---|---|
Mudjacking | $500 - $1,200 |
Polyurethane Foam Injection | $900 - $2,500 |
Concrete Resurfacing | $3 - $7 per square foot |
Crack Repair | $300 - $800 |
Foundation Repair | $2,000 - $7,000 |
Leveling Small Slab | $300 - $600 |
